2. Safety Information
- Always disconnect the AC power cord from the wall outlet before installing or removing the power supply.
- Do not open the power supply unit. High voltages are present inside, which can cause serious injury or death.
- Ensure your computer case and components are properly grounded.
- Use only genuine SAMA modular cables. Third-party cables might not be compatible and could cause serious damage to your system.
- Avoid operating the power supply in high humidity or high-temperature environments.
- Do not insert any objects into the fan grille or ventilation openings.

5. Setup and Installation
- Prepare Your PC Case: Ensure your PC case has adequate space for the power supply and proper ventilation.
- Mount the Power Supply: Secure the SAMA GT850-White into the designated PSU bay of your PC case using the provided mounting screws.
- Connect Modular Cables: Identify the necessary cables for your motherboard, CPU, GPU, and peripherals. Connect these cables to the corresponding modular ports on the power supply. Refer to the labels on the PSU for correct connections.
- Connect to Components:
- Motherboard: Connect the 24-pin ATX cable to your motherboard.
- CPU: Connect the 4+4-pin or 8-pin CPU power cable(s) to your motherboard.
- GPU: Connect the appropriate PCIe cables (e.g., 12V-2x6 for RTX 40 series, or 6+2-pin for other GPUs) to your graphics card(s).
- Peripherals: Connect SATA power cables to SSDs, HDDs, and other SATA-powered devices. Connect Molex cables if needed.
- Cable Management: Route the cables neatly behind the motherboard tray or in designated cable management channels to improve airflow and aesthetics. Use cable ties if necessary.
- Connect AC Power: Once all internal connections are secure, connect the AC power cord to the power supply and then to a wall outlet.

6. Operating Instructions
- Powering On: After connecting all cables, flip the power switch on the back of the PSU to the 'ON' (I) position. Then, power on your computer using the case's power button.
- Powering Off: To shut down your system, use the operating system's shutdown function. For a complete power cycle, flip the power switch on the back of the PSU to the 'OFF' (O) position and disconnect the AC power cord.
- ECO Fan Mode: The 120mm ECO fan operates intelligently. At low loads, the fan may remain off for silent operation. It will automatically activate as the load increases to maintain optimal temperatures.
7. Maintenance
- Cleaning: Periodically clean the exterior of the power supply and its fan grille to prevent dust buildup, which can hinder cooling performance. Use compressed air or a soft, dry cloth. Ensure the power supply is off and disconnected from the AC outlet before cleaning.
- Cable Management: Regularly check cable connections to ensure they are secure. Re-organize cables if they become dislodged or interfere with airflow.
8. Troubleshooting
- No Power:
- Check if the AC power cord is securely connected to both the wall outlet and the power supply.
- Ensure the power switch on the back of the PSU is in the 'ON' (I) position.
- Verify all modular cables are correctly and firmly seated in both the power supply and the respective components.
- Test the wall outlet with another device to confirm it has power.
- System Instability/Random Shutdowns:
- Ensure your system's power requirements do not exceed the 850W capacity of the PSU.
- Check for proper ventilation within your PC case to prevent overheating.
- Confirm all power connections are secure.
- Excessive Fan Noise:
- The fan speed adjusts based on load. High load will result in higher fan speed and noise.
- Ensure the fan grille is free from dust and obstructions.
- If the fan is constantly loud even under low load, contact customer support.
9.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model | GT850-White |
| Output Wattage | 850 Watts |
| Efficiency Certification | 80 PLUS Gold |
| ATX Standard | ATX 3.1 Compatible |
| PCIe Standard | PCIe 5.1 Compliant |
| Form Factor | ATX |
| Cooling Method | Air (120mm FDB ECO Fan) |
| Product Dimensions (L x W x H) | 5.51 x 5.91 x 3.39 inches (140 x 150 x 86 mm) |
| Item Weight | 4.66 pounds |
| Minimum Input Voltage | 85 Volts (AC) |
| Capacitors | Japanese Capacitors |
